Rehearsal

Rehearsal is the continuous repetition of

a name or an image of items to be

remembered

Requires the least effort and is natural

ElaborationDefined as the association between two

concepts, items, or images, creating links

between newly learned concepts and stored

concepts

Childhood Amnesia Phase—Birth to 3 yearsTime of great learningGreat need for memory function

Memory systems are necessary for survival

The memory functions of the brain are developed but not fully connected

As the memory system becomes

more adept at remembering things,

long term recall becomes stronger

and we begin to have memories.
